Modernizing the Silents

Silent films were never silent – anything from a lone piano player to a full orchestra was there to elevate and accentuate the story on the screen as it unfolded.

The Mary Pickford Foundation is encouraging young and gifted composers and musicians by having them write, record and perform original scores for our newly restored and digitally mastered films. We work diligently to produce new scores that not only compliment the films, but also entice a new generation to discover Mary Pickford. Below is a glimpse of what goes into that work.
